Error Occurred At Recursive Sql Level
Contents |
Digital Records Management Enterprise Content Management Strategy Digital Asset Management Oracle Imaging & Process Management Web Content Management Oracle WebCenter Portal Enterprise Portal Support Enterprise Portal Strategy Enterprise Portal Upgrade Oracle WebCenter Sites Sourcing Staffing & Recruiting Recruiting Managed Services Candidate Registration
Error Occurred At Recursive Sql Level 1
Technical Focus Client Opportunities Support Solutions Training Legacy to Oracle WebCenter Oracle Documents Cloud error occurred at recursive sql level 1 no statement parsed Service Next Generation AP Automation & Dynamic Discounting Oracle WebCenter Contract Lifecycle Management (CLM) Search ORA-00604: error occurred at recursive SQL
Error Occurred At Recursive Sql Level 1 Ora-01000 Maximum Open Cursors Exceeded
level 1You are here: Home / Resources / ORA-00604: error occurred at recursive SQL level 1 Error ORA-00604 is a commonly seen error by Oracle users, and one that can sometimes be tricky to error occurred at recursive sql level s solve. ORA-00604 occurs while processing a recursive SQL statement. A recursive SQL statement is a statement that is applied to internal dictionary tables. Because there are many possible reasons for the error, Oracle simply states that if the situation described in the next error on the stack can be corrected, it should be corrected. Otherwise, the user should contact the Oracle support line. An example of error ORA-00604 error occurred at recursive sql level 1 maximum open cursors exceeded in Oracle 11g is “error occurred at recursive SQL level 1” in which table or view does not exist. A possible cause for recursive SQL errors is a trigger. If this is the case, you may have experienced the trigger attempting to insert records into an audit log table, the audit log table being dropped by your cleanup script, or a trigger that fires for every DDL statement. To make sure that the error is related to a trigger issue, execute the following SQL statement: Alter system set “_system_trig_enabled”=FALSE; To view all of the triggers, execute the following SQL statement: SELECT * FROM dba_triggers WHERE trigger_type not in (‘before each row’,’after each row’) To find the most relevant triggers, filter the triggering_event column. Find the trigger that is causing the problem and disable it or drop it to resolve the issue. Usually, this error occurs in the Oracle database by the system level triggers on DDL or SYSTEM events. Another example of error ORA-00604 is when the user attempts to run a newly-created table using SELECT* from cdc. In this case, the DBMS_CDC_PUBLISH package needs to be recompiled using SYS. The user should recompile until invalid packages are no longer viewed. The Error ORA-00
here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of
Error Occurred At Recursive Sql Level 2
this site About Us Learn more about Stack Overflow the company Business Learn ora-00604 error occurred at recursive sql level 2 more about hiring developers or posting ads with us Stack Overflow Questions Jobs Documentation Tags Users Badges Ask Question
Ora-604 Error Occurred At Recursive Sql Level
x Dismiss Join the Stack Overflow Community Stack Overflow is a community of 4.7 million programmers, just like you, helping each other. Join them; it only takes a minute: Sign up https://www.tekstream.com/resources/ora-00604-error-at-recursive-sql-level-1/ Oracle 11g: ORA-00604: error occurred at recursive SQL level 1 up vote 2 down vote favorite 1 I executed the script below and it works: BEGIN FOR cur_rec IN (SELECT object_name, object_type FROM user_objects WHERE object_type IN ('TABLE', 'VIEW', 'PACKAGE', 'PROCEDURE', 'FUNCTION', 'SEQUENCE' )) LOOP BEGIN IF cur_rec.object_type = 'TABLE' THEN EXECUTE IMMEDIATE 'DROP ' || cur_rec.object_type || ' "' || cur_rec.object_name || http://stackoverflow.com/questions/24901645/oracle-11g-ora-00604-error-occurred-at-recursive-sql-level-1 '" CASCADE CONSTRAINTS'; ELSE EXECUTE IMMEDIATE 'DROP ' || cur_rec.object_type || ' "' || cur_rec.object_name || '"'; END IF; EXCEPTION WHEN OTHERS THEN DBMS_OUTPUT.put_line ( 'FAILED: DROP ' || cur_rec.object_type || ' "' || cur_rec.object_name || '"' ); END; END LOOP; END; / But the problem is, after this, I cant grant, create or drop etc. in my database even I'm using a sysdba user. I am getting the error: ORA-00604: error occurred at recursive SQL level 1 ORA-00942: table or view does not exist Please help. Thanks. sql oracle11g share|improve this question edited Jul 23 '14 at 4:28 Jens Wirth 6,29331228 asked Jul 23 '14 at 4:04 beautifulmonster 13115 Please tell me you didn't run that script as the SYS or SYSTEM user... –Frank Schmitt Jul 23 '14 at 5:54 no. i use a different user on running this script which is ICBI. –beautifulmonster Jul 23 '14 at 5:57 add a comment| 1 Answer 1 active oldest votes up vote 2 down vote accepted One possible cause for the recursive SQL error is triggers. You might have run into this scenario: you ha
SQL TuningSecurityOracle UNIXOracle LinuxMonitoringRemote supportRemote plansRemote servicesApplication Server ApplicationsOracle FormsOracle PortalApp UpgradesSQL ServerOracle ConceptsSoftware SupportRemote Support Development Implementation Consulting StaffConsulting PricesHelp Wanted! Oracle PostersOracle Books Oracle Scripts Ion Excel-DB Don Burleson Blog http://www.dba-oracle.com/sf_ora_00604_error_occurred_and_recursive_sql_level_string.htm
ORA-00604: error occurred at recursive SQL level string tips Oracle Error Tips by Burleson Consulting Oracle docs note https://knowledge.exlibrisgroup.com/Aleph/Knowledge_Articles/Error_occurred_at_recursive_SQL_level_2%3B_unable_to_allocate_2088_bytes_of_shared this about ORA-00604: ORA-00604: error occurred at recursive SQL level string Cause: An error occurred while processing a recursive SQL statement (a statement applying to internal dictionary tables). Action: If the error occurred situation described in the next error on the stack can be corrected, do so; otherwise contact Oracle Support. Many users of the new Oracle 11i find themselves being confronted by ORA-00604. On this forum, a user finds ORA-00604 after attempting to run a newly created table using select*from cdc; The message they are receiving is: ORA-00604: Une erreur s'est produite au niveau SQL r?ursif 1 error occurred at ORA-04068: ?at de packages existant rejet? ORA-04063: package body "SYS.DBMS_CDC_PUBLISH" a des erreurs ORA-06508: PL/SQL : Impossible de trouver unit?de programme appel?br> ORA-06512: ?ligne 3 They are wondering how to get rid of ORA-00604. The user found that to resolve ORA-00604, they needed to try re-compiling their DBMS_CDC_PUBLISH package using SYS. Running this repeatedly until invalid packages no longer show, should clear up any issues throwing ORA-00604. For more information in this process, you can refer to this article: http://www.dba-oracle.com/t_recompile_reco...lid_objects.htm �� Burleson is the American Team Note: This Oracle documentation was created as a support and Oracle training reference for use by our DBA performance tuning consulting professionals. Feel free to ask questions on our Oracle forum. Verify experience! Anyone considering using the services of an Oracle support expert should independently investigate their credentials and experience, and not rely on advertisements and self-proclaimed expertise. All legitimate Oracle experts publish their Oracle qualifications. Errata? Oracle technology is changing and we strive to update our BC OrSign in Expand/collapse global hierarchy Home Aleph Knowledge Articles Expand/collapse global location Error occurred at recursive SQL level 2; unable to allocate 2088 bytes of shared Last updated 09:57, 9 Dec 2015 Save as PDF Share Share Share Tweet Share No headers Article Type: General Product: Aleph Product Version: 20 Description:We went up on version 20 over the weekend, receiving ORA errors in the alert log starting at 03:34 this morning:Thu Feb 03 03:34:52 2011Errors in file /exlibris/app/oracle/admin/aleph1/ddump/diag/rdbms/aleph1/aleph1/trace/aleph1_cjq0_28143.trc:ORA-00604: error occurred at recursive SQL level 2ORA-04031: unable to allocate 2088 bytes of shared memory ("shared pool","select job, nvl2(last_date, ...","CCursor","kgltbsgp")Thu Feb 03 03:35:03 2011Errors in file /exlibris/app/oracle/admin/aleph1/ddump/diag/rdbms/aleph1/aleph1/trace/aleph1_cjq0_28143.trc:ORA-00604: error occurred at recursive SQL level 2ORA-04031: unable to allocate 2088 bytes of shared memory ("shared pool","select job, nvl2(last_date, ...","CCursor","kgltbsgp")Thu Feb 03 03:36:44 2011Errors in file /exlibris/app/oracle/admin/aleph1/ddump/diag/rdbms/aleph1/aleph1/trace/aleph1_cjq0_28143.trc:ORA-00604: error occurred at recursive SQL level 1ORA-04031: unable to allocate 256 bytes of shared memory ("shared pool","unknown object","CCursor","kglob")Thu Feb 03 03:36:50 2011Errors in file /exlibris/app/oracle/admin/aleph1/ddump/diag/rdbms/aleph1/aleph1/trace/aleph1_j000_18643.trc:ORA-12012: error on auto execute of job 1ORA-04031: unable to allocate 2088 bytes of shared memory ("shared pool","select u1.user#, u2.user#, u...","CCursor","kgltbsgp")Thu Feb 03 03:44:01 2011PMON failed to delete process, see PMON trace fileThu Feb 03 04:04:42 2011Errors in file /exlibris/app/oracle/admin/aleph1/ddump/diag/rdbms/aleph1/aleph1/trace/aleph1_reco_16362.trc:ORA-00604: error occurred at recursive SQL level 1ORA-00018: maximum number of sessions exceededThu Feb 03 04:16:17 2011Errors in file /exlibris/app/oracle/admin/aleph1/ddump/diag/rdbms/aleph1/aleph1/trac